Is it possible on the Lockdown screen for it to behave like any Android/iPhone device does when there is a text message you have not read or a phone call you have missed and shows the number over the SMS/Phone icon?

I have the Lockdown pointing to the default Android dialer (com.android.dialer) and using the default icon but when a device misses a call the only indication is the small phone icon in the top taskbar.

Interested if there is a way around this no matter how creative.

I'm pretty sure it's because, the icon on the lockdown doesn't act like the icon from the homescreen (completely different) and because of that doesn't show that bubble.

I guess you may need to grab that number somehow like with an intent or so on some kind of schedule and then show a own created bubble with the relevant number on the lockdown (has to be done in the lockdown template.

But i have no idea how or if that's possible as my research somehow looked like you may need a own written sub-app providing this information for example in an ini or xml file which can then be retrived by the lockdown via JS as a number and then displayed there.
